Generations upon generations of artists obtained their inspirations or practice materials from fellow artists -past, present or contemporaries from Rubens simulating Poussin to Ingres, etc.
Using a sable or furry brush to embellish a drawing originally sketched in graphite is a worthy task/challenge to master.
But foremost, mastering human anatomy is paramount when depicting figures in action.
Master comix script illustrator Alfredo Alcala showed his intimate knowledge of human anatomy, and his woodblock-style of brush renderings are admirably impeccable. My versions, I would say, are more fine arts inclined.
